Director :
Stars :
Nicholas ThurkettleRebecca Shoultz
Genre :
Release :
2018-11-07
Rating :
6.2
Story :
Robin and Raymond have come to this idyllic cabin in the mountains to get away from the stress and toxicity of modern life, and work on a project that will make the world a better place, while being the ultimate expression of their love....